A book or set of books containing articles on various topics, usually in alphabetical arrangement, covering all branches of knowledge or, less commonly, all aspects of one subject.

Encyclopedia Britannica
Britannica.com includes the complete, updated Encyclopedia Britannica, the oldest and largest general reference in the English language.
